Breaking Down the Features of VWR Advanced Dry Block Heater 120V with Heated Lid
Specifications
The VWR Advanced Dry Block Heater 120V with Heated Lid operates on 120V power, making it compatible with standard electrical outlets. The heater is specifically designed for use in the food and beverage industry and general laboratory applications. It features an ultra-thin copper barrier plate positioned beneath the chamber.
This copper plate facilitates warm air circulation to the product surface. A mirror-image stainless steel sleeve encases the heating elements. This stainless steel sleeve provides corrosion resistance.
The nickel-plated copper chamber ensures smooth operation of the heating elements. It includes a durable stainless steel valve with three positions, preventing the lid from accidentally catching. It comes with a nylon-covered carrying handle for easy transport. The heater has a white nylon-covered exterior case, providing an easy-to-clean surface.
